Brigg's First Show




We do very few UKA Shows but as Brigg had just turned 18 months this was an ideal introduction for his first show. Tuesday dawned overcast with the threat of rain when were bound for Mapledurham and the Quad Paws Show. As I wanted to avoid travelling through Reading during the rush hour I went the scenic route following my satnav down narrow country roads and at one point meeting a traction engine which meant my reversing some 50 yards to the nearest passing point, thank God I was not towing my caravan!! I arrived in good time to walk my classes in the rain which continued on and off for most of the day. This was only a small show which was ideal for Brigg's debut. I must admit the day was fraught as the class numbers were small the classes went through fast and at one point I found I had to take Brigg from one ring to another for three consecutive runs which is a bit much for a young lad, however he did really well. I ran Brigg NFC in Agility when he did a lovely round getting all his contacts after which I played with him, Chart also went NFC, he launched himself off the contacts as usual only to be made to repeat them which was something of a shock to him!! Kai came 4th in Senior Agility despite faults having left the see saw in style! Keets came 4th in Beginners jumping with Brigg a hundredth of a second behind him, having completed a lovely clear round Brigg came 4th in the Beginners Steeplechase.
Saturday and again we were bound for Mapledurham this time travelling through Reading. Such a contrast in the weather, it was already hot and humid by the time I arrived and I was glad to change into my shorts. Again classes were small and I was constantly walking back and forth changing dogs. Kai came 2nd in jumping and Keets also 2nd in Agility giving him the required points to at last move up into the Novice category, he just failed to qualify for the CSJ Final as they took the top 3 dogs in Maxi height and he came 4th! Brigg was a very good boy again just knocking a pole in two of his runs however he stormed home to take 4th place in the Beginners Steeplechase this time beating Keets by a second! Chart was just out of the places in the jumping but he did at least go clear which was encouraging especially after some traumatic rounds previously!! Thames next weekend and Brigg's first KC Show. Quite often one finds that the dog one trains is not the same dog when in the show ring, this is very true with Chart and Kai, however Brigg in the ring behaved just the same as in training, such a good honest boy, I am very thrilled with him!
